Pneumatic Tool/Rock Drill/Sawmill Oils |
Engine
Armour Pneumatic Tool/Rock Drill/ Sawmill Lubricants have been designed
to bring strong extreme pressure (EP) performance under the most demanding
applications. Resistant to water wash-off, this series of lubricants
protects surfaces under conditions of pneumatic percussion, which may
lead to rifling damage. In addition the product is designed to lubricated
say blades without leading to a build up of pitch deposits.
Engine Armour Pneumatic Tool/Rock Drill/ Sawmill Lubricants are useful in a variety of applications, such as tools that require extreme pressure properties for protection of equipment under high load conditions and tack adhesion to the work surface. These lubricants will protect against rust formation on tool parts. Engine Armour Pneumatic Tool/Rock Drill/ Sawmill Lubricants contain additives that minimize spray mist. This is particularly important in sawmill applications. In sawmill applications Engine Armour Pneumatic Tool/Rock Drill/ Sawmill Lubricants will cling tenaciously to the blade lowering lubricant replacement costs. These oils contain an EP agent and various chemical components to control wear, oxidation, sludge, corrosion and foaming. These products are formulated in various ISO viscosity grades, with varying high and low temperature properties depending on ambient condition.

Multi-Use Industrial Oils |
Engine
Armour Multi-Use Industrial Oil is formulated as a general workshop oil
to bring slide-way, hydraulic, and gear performance in a single lubricant.
The product thus allows significant inventory and supply chain cost reduction,
and minimizes the possibility of lubricant misapplication. Engine Armour
Multi-Use Industrial Oils protect ways which often carry machine tools
in severe environments. Performance attributes that are needed by a sideway
lubricant can vary significantly from application to application, though
the following are very common: Antiwear/extreme pressure performance,
anti-rust performance, yellow metal corrosion resistance, and anti-oxidancy.
In addition, the smooth operation of the way can lead to improved accuracy
and quality, so strong friction performance as measured by stick-slip
resistance is essential. Given the proximity of the way to machine tools
and their cutting fluids, a degree of separation from the cutting fluid
is also needed. Indeed, emulsion-type cutting fluids will not be damaged
by mixing with the Engine Armour Multi-Use Industrial Oil, as often this
fluid is separated and circulated back to the cutting tool. This product
is formulated in various ISO viscosity grades, with varying high and
low temperature properties depending on ambient conditions.

Spindle/Needle Bearing Oils |
Engine
Armour Spindle/Needle Bearing Lubricants are low viscosity oils used
to lubricate the bearings of commercial sewing and textile equipment
where the yarn or fabric does not contact the lubricant. These oils are
also recommended for high-speed spindle bearings in precision grinders
and other machine tools requiring low-viscosity oils. The product offers
strong oxidation and rust resistance properties. The higher the viscosity
index (VI) of these oils reduced the tendency for stray mist or fogging
in higher speed applications.
Engine Armour Spindle/Needle Bearing Lubricants are suitable for use wherever strong antiwear protection, oxidation protection, and rust inhibition are required.
Not recommended for applications where the spindle oil contact the yarn or Fabric.

Way Lube - Superior Oils |
Engine
Armour Way Lube - Superior Oils are premium slide-way lubricants which
are formulated to protect slide-ways which carry machine tools in severe
environments including plain bearing slide-ways of lathes, shapers, grinders,
and milling machines. Performance attributes afforded by Engine Armour
Way Lubes include: Antiwear/extreme pressure performance, anti-rust performance,
yellow metal corrosion resistance, and anti-oxidancy. In addition, the
smooth operation of the way is seen when Engine Armour Way Lube is used,
can lead to improved accuracy and quality, which is a result of Engine
Armours Way Lubes strong friction performance as measured by stick-slip
resistance. Given the proximity of the way to machine tools and their
cutting fluids, a degree of separation from the cutting fluid is desirable.
Engine Armour Way Lubes separate easily from a variety of emulsion-type
cutting fluids which allow them to be separated and circulated back to
the cutting tool. Engine Armour Way Lubes also contain tackiness additives
to ensure good adherence of the oil to both vertical and horizontal ways,
and to prevent any cutting fluid from washing away the slide-way oil.
This product is formulated in various ISO viscosity grades, with varying
high and low temperature properties depending on ambient conditions.
They are suitable for use wherever Cincinnati Machine slide-way oil performance
is called for and meet stringent performance requirements.
Heavy Duty Bearing/Circulating Oils |
Engine
Armour Heavy Duty Bearing/Circulating Lubricants are formulated
to protect high-speed, no-twist rod mills such as those manufactured
by Morgan Construction Company USA. Engine Armour Heavy Duty Bearing/Circulating
Lubricants are formulated to bring outstanding rust and corrosion control
in gears, shafts, bearing screws, and internal housing sections. Balanced
corrosion protection is very necessary to counteract water from condensation
and roll neck seal leakage. These lubricants will also ensure that oil-return
lines will be protected from corrosion. In addition, these lubricants
resist the formation of oil-water emulsions and have good water separability.
Engine Armour Heavy Duty Bearing/Circulating Lubricants are formulated with anti-wear additives to protect gearing against scuffing and scoring. Film strength and other properties bring low friction or low break-away torque which is critical to good ball, roller and oil film bearing operations.
